TROUBLESHOOTING
Cooling System Overheating
Low coolant level Air in cooling system Wrong typemix of coolant Faulty pressure cap or system leaks Restricted system (mud or debris in radiator fins causing restriction to air flow, passages blocked in radiator, lines, pump, or water jacket, accident damage) Lean mixture (fuel system restriction) Fuel pump output weak Electrical malfunction
